| With increasing emphasis which the Chinese government attaches to livelihood issues,establishment of a complete social and medical security system has become a major government project.The No.14 Document issued by the State Council Office in 2015 clearly stipulates the task of building a basic electronic health archive system with dynamic update throughout China by 2020.The key to realizing the vision relies on effective integration of the current scientific and medical achievements as well as on systematic collection and unified management of health data.In fact,China has come up with relevant product R&D findings.However,these physical examination products are complex in operations,high in price and not user-friendly.As a result,they fail to meet the domestic market demands of physical examination.In order to solve the above problems,this paper studies based on the product integration and development model,and proposes a cheaper multi-functional self-help physical examination terminal,which caters to needs of target consumers of physical examination and simplifies operation.It is hoped that the physical examination terminal can help realize one-stop self-help physical examination and unified management of health data,contribute to establishment of a wisdom city,and popularize physical examination among all Chinese..Based on integration of physical examination demands and investigation,the product development task book is formulated.Then,via the function catalog,the principle of functioning is worked out.Meanwhile,the R&D of critical parts is proved to obtain the final function structural catalog.After that,knowledge of anthropometry is used to optimize the function structure in terms of space configuration and dimension so as to realize organic integration of multiple functions.Based on that,spectral clustering is adopted to conduct cluster calculation of the product function structure at an attempt to obtain productfunction mix hierarchy,and realize modularized design of the driving structure of the function model.Finally,through the behavior analysis system,a reasonableness check is conducted of the product R&D outcome.The main research content of this paper is shown below:(1)Establishment of a product integration and development model: Study relevant theoretical methods of integration,modularization and anthropometry to provide methods and theoretical basis for the product integration and development model.(2)Applied research of the modularization design methods of function module driving structure module: Conduct clustering of functions based on reasonable space planning of functions and hierarchical clustering methods,and explore the modularization design method which drives structural modular design via the function module;(3)Applied research of anthropometry in product function integration and development: Design the interaction process based on analysis of functional technical requirements,realize reasonable space planning of functions,and confirm the critical man-machine dimensions based on the appearance design to achieve organic integration of product function structure;(4)R&D and design of critical components of the multi-functional physical examination product: Confirm the key R&D techniques while working out functions,analyze the functional dimension of man-machine interaction,and prove the design feasibility of the blood pressure automatic measurement component and the automatic lifting component;(5)Prototyping test and evaluation: Analyze the movement angle and the operational movement sequence in the man-machine interaction of the prototype via the behavior analysis system.Combine the user questionnaire survey results to evaluate the overall functions of new products so as to guide the follow-up improvement of product design.R&D of the physical examination terminal in this paper can make physical examination equipment easier for target users to operate and achieve one-stop self-help physical examination.Through establishment of the cloud health data archives,unified management and dynamic update of health data are realized.The physical examination terminal developed in this paper can alleviate thepressure of the manual physical examination,promote building of a wisdom city,and boost the construction of the medical care service system. |
